Vogue Nippon magazine has recently revealed the winners of its “Women of the Year 2008″ award. The annual event showcases the outstanding Japanese women of the year in various fields, primarily in the pop culture industry.

The nine winners of Vogue Nippon Women of the Year 2008 are actress Aoi Miyazaki, actress Juri Ueno, comedian Harumi Edo, softball player Yukiko Ueno, Buddhist activist-writer Jakucho Setouchi, singer-writer Mieko Kawakami, talent-idol Suzanne, manga artist Yukari Ichijo and actress Kanako Higuchi…

MTV Japan’s Student Voice Awards 2008 were presented last Tuesday (Aug 26) at Studio Coast, Kōtō-ku, Tokyo

The winners (via Tokyograph)…

Best Artist: YUI
Best Dance Artist: AAA
Best Group: Ikimono Gakari
Best Actor: Shun Oguri
Best Actress: Juri Ueno
Best Love Song: “Soba ni Iru ne”, Thelma Aoyama feat SoulJa
Best Lyrics: “Home”, Shōta Shimizu
Best Party Karaoke: “Polyrhythm”, Perfume
Best Ringtone: “Kiseki”, GReeeeN
Best Movie: “Koizora”
Best Game: “Monster Hunter Portable 2nd G”
Best Athlete: Ryo Ishikawa
Best Comedian: Harumi Edo
Best Fashionista: Jun Hasegawa
Best Trend: “Wisshu~” (DAIGO)
Respect Award: AI
